Creative Resilience is a collaborative initiative of the UNESCO Division for Gender Equality and its Natural Sciences Sector. Creative Resilience is an art exhibition featuring the creative expressions of women in science during the COVID-19 pandemic. The UNESCO Creative Cities Network was created in 2004 to promote cooperation with and among cities that have identified creativity as a strategic factor for sustainable urban development. As of 2017, there are 180 cities from 72 countries in the network.. UNESCO applies a zero tolerance policy against all forms of harassment .
